The smoke of the hearth rises where the hunter’s fire once burned. Seeds replace spears, and footpaths widen into roads of exchange. At the river’s edge, farming anchors families in place. A surplus of grain creates specialists—potters, priests, and rulers—and villages swell into the first walled towns.
